Possibility of Hazardous Reactions
None under normal processing.
Conditions to avoid
Exposure to air or moisture over prolonged periods. Extremes of temperature and direct sunlight.
Incompatible materials
Strong oxidizing agents. Do not mix with other swimming pool/spa chemicals in their concentrated forms.
Hazardous Decomposition Products
None known based on information supplied.
11. TOXICOLOGICAL INFORMATION
Information on likely routes of exposure
Inhalation
May cause irritation of respiratory tract.
Eye contact
Irritating to eyes. May cause burns.
Skin contact
May cause irritation.
Ingestion
Harmful if swallowed.
Chemical Name Oral LD50 Dermal LD50 Inhalation LC50
calcium chloride
10043-52-4
= 1000 mg/kg ( Rat ) = 2630 mg/kg ( Rat ) -
